Bug#310801: Failed: mips(el) (cobalt): no aptitude package in woody for mips(el)



retitle 310801 [Release notes] no working aptitude on woody hppa/mips/mipsel

On Thu, May 26, 2005 at 04:35:30PM +1200, Ewen McNeill wrote:
> but it doesn't include aptitude at this stage.
> 
> It seems to me that either:
> (a) aptitude should be built for Woody on all Sarge architectures, and
>     included in 3.0r6; or
> 
> (b) on those architectures where aptitude isn't available (ie, mips(el))
>     the release notes should provide alternative instructions on 
>     upgrading (eg, using apt-get cautiously, or perhaps doing enough
>     of the upgrade to pull in aptitude from Sarge then using aptitude).

Woody g++ is not able to build aptitude on hppa, mips and mipsel. Since
woody packages need to build with woody g++, there is no possibility to
fix that bug in woody, unfortunately.

> I'm sure that I can figure out some way to upgrade this system to Sarge
> even if neither of those are done (I've backported enough packages myself
> for one thing; and done Debian upgrades since Bo without using aptitude),
> but in the interests of accurate documention it seems something worth
> addressing.

We are aware of this bug and are considering what alternatives to
propose.  So far, the best alternative we have is to ask mips/el users to do:
apt-get update
apt-get install aptitude
aptitude -f dist-upgrade

Would that work for you ?
